  • Patent number: 11606908
    Abstract: A knotter drive apparatus for a baler includes a knotter gear drive shaft having a drive shaft axis and a shaft outside diameter. A plurality of knotter assemblies are mounted on the knotter gear drive shaft. Each assembly includes a first knotter gear sector including a first sector hub portion and a first sector radial portion. The first sector hub portion includes a central passage at least partly defined in the first sector hub portion for receiving the knotter gear drive shaft. The first sector radial portion extends radially outward from the first sector hub portion relative to the drive shaft axis, and has defined thereon a plurality of intermittent gear tooth segments. The first sector hub portion has a circumferential gap defined therein greater than the shaft outside diameter such that the first knotter gear sector is removable radially, relative to the drive shaft axis, from the knotter gear drive shaft.

  • Patent number: 10525650
    Abstract: A baler is provided that includes a housing that defines a baling chamber and a plunger movable along an axis within the baling chamber to compress the crop material. The baler includes a first guide rail coupled to an exterior surface of the baling chamber and a second guide rail coupled to the exterior surface of the baling chamber. The baler includes at least one bearing coupled to the plunger to guide a movement of the plunger within the baling chamber. The bearing has a first bearing surface, a second bearing surface and a third bearing surface. The first bearing surface engages the first guide rail, the second bearing surface engages the first guide rail and the third bearing surface engages the second guide rail to constrain a vertical movement and a lateral movement of the plunger relative to the baling chamber.
